Zalando replaces Bertrandt in German MDAX index

FRANKFURT, June 3 (Reuters) - Europe's largest dedicated 
online fashion retailer Zalando  ZALG.DE  will be added to 
Germany's mid-cap index MDAX  .MDAXI , following their flotation 
on the Frankfurt stock exchange last year. 
    Stock exchange operator Deutsche Boerse  DB1Gn.DE  said on 
Wednesday the stock would replace shares by automotive supplier 
Bertrandt  BDTG.DE , which will move to the SDAX  .SDAXI  
small-cap index. 
    Shares in Zalando have gained about 41 percent since their 
stock market debut in October, outperforming a 29 percent 
increase by the MDAX as it rode the coattails of e-commerce 
flotations like China's Alibaba  BABA.N . 
    The composition of the DAX index of Germany's 30 biggest 
companies will remain unchanged, Deutsche Boerse said on 
Wednesday. 
    The shares of Tele Columbus AG  TC1n.DE , Koenig & Bauer AG 
 SKBG.DE  and ADLER Real Estate AG  ADLG.DE  will be included in 
the SDAX small-cap index, Deutsche Boerse said. The shares of 
Surteco SE  SURG.DE , Delticom AG  DEXGn.DE  and BAUER AG 
 B5AG.DE  will be deleted from the index. 
    In the exchange operator's TecDAX, the share of ADVA Optical 
Networking SE  ADAG.DE  will be included and will replace the 
share of BB Biotech AG  BION.S . 
    Deutsche Boerse said that as a result of the acquisition by 
ADLER Real Estate, the Westgrund AG  WEG1.DE  current share 
class in SDAX will be replaced with the tendered share class of 
Westgrund AG. 
   The index changes will become effective on June 22, except 
for unscheduled index changes which will become effective in 
June 8. The next regular index review will be held on September 
3, the company said.
